Henry Wotton

Henry Wotton (1568–1639) was a poet, diplomat and writer.

Overview

Born at Boughton Place in 1568, died at Eton College in 1639.

In detail

Henry Wotton studied at The Queen's College and Winchester College. the recorded working language is English.

The field of work recorded is diplomacy and poetry.

Employment is recorded with Eton College. Positions recorded include Member of Parliament in the Parliament of England and ambassador.

Distinctions recorded are Knight Bachelor.
